Pancake/Waffle Breakfast

 
All-You-Can-Eat Pancake and Waffle Breakfast - $5

Tomorrow, November 19th, between 9AM and 11:30AM, you can help yourself to an all you can eat pancake/waffle breakfast for $5 in the LSB 213 Lounge. Tons of toppings are available. Bring your own cup for free juice!

Presented by McMaster Undergraduate Biology Society.
